Information card for entry 4517739
Preview
| Coordinates | 4517739.cif |
|---|---|
| Original paper (by DOI) | HTML |
| Formula | C15 H16 O10 |
|---|---|
| Calculated formula | C15 H15.5 O10 |
| SMILES | O1c2c(c(O)cc(O)c2)C(=O)[C@H](O)[C@H]1c1cc(O)c(O)c(O)c1.O[C@@H]1C(=O)c2c(O[C@H]1c1cc(O)c(O)c(O)c1)cc(O)cc2O.O.O.O.O |
| Title of publication | New Method for Extracting and Purifying Dihydromyricetin from <i>Ampelopsis grossedentata</i>. |
| Authors of publication | Hu, Hongchao; Luo, Fan; Wang, Mingjie; Fu, Zhihuan; Shu, Xugang |
| Journal of publication | ACS omega |
| Year of publication | 2020 |
| Journal volume | 5 |
| Journal issue | 23 |
| Pages of publication | 13955 - 13962 |
| a | 15.3733 ± 0.0001 Å |
| b | 7.8961 ± 0.0001 Å |
| c | 24.1511 ± 0.0002 Å |
| α | 90° |
| β | 92.627 ± 0.001° |
| γ | 90° |
| Cell volume | 2928.6 ± 0.05 Å3 |
| Cell temperature | 100 ± 0.17 K |
| Ambient diffraction temperature | 100 ± 0.17 K |
| Number of distinct elements | 3 |
| Space group number | 14 |
| Hermann-Mauguin space group symbol | P 1 21/c 1 |
| Hall space group symbol | -P 2ybc |
| Residual factor for all reflections | 0.0382 |
| Residual factor for significantly intense reflections | 0.0344 |
| Weighted residual factors for significantly intense reflections | 0.0933 |
| Weighted residual factors for all reflections included in the refinement | 0.0956 |
| Goodness-of-fit parameter for all reflections included in the refinement | 1.064 |
| Diffraction radiation probe | x-ray |
| Diffraction radiation wavelength | 1.54184 Å |
| Diffraction radiation type | CuKα |
| Has coordinates | Yes |
| Has disorder | No |
| Has Fobs | No |
